VIP3‑31A‑30(B031SO378) is a three‑phase three‑wire industrial EMI power filter engineered for heavy‑duty industrial AC power supply systems. Built with optimized composite filtering circuitry, it delivers effective suppression on both common‑mode and differential‑mode conducted interference transmitted through power lines. This chassis‑mounted filter adopts premium passive components, featuring solid insulation property and outstanding high‑voltage withstand performance. It improves power supply quality for host devices and reduces noise cross‑interference inside electrical cabinets. Every unit undergoes strict factory inspection to maintain stable filtering capability across a wide working temperature range. As a vital anti‑interference accessory, it facilitates end‑product EMC compliance for industrial equipment manufacturers and system integrators.![]()
This three‑phase power filter is rated for 380/480VAC, with maximum RMS current of 30A at 480VAC and fits 50/60Hz power frequency. The maximum line‑to‑ground leakage current is 2.0mA under 480VAC, 60Hz condition. For one‑minute high‑potential test, line‑to‑ground withstand voltage is 2000VAC while line‑to‑line withstand voltage reaches 1450VDC. Insulation resistance is no less than 100M ohms when measured at 500VDC between input, output terminals and ground. Its operating ambient temperature covers ‑25℃ to +100℃. Tested under 50‑ohm system, it obtains favorable insertion‑loss performance against common‑mode and differential‑mode noise over broad frequency bands.![]()
It eliminates conducted electromagnetic noise existing on three‑phase AC power lines. It blocks grid‑borne interference from invading equipment and prevents internal noise of machinery from feeding back to public power grid. It avoids equipment misoperation and signal disorder triggered by electromagnetic disturbance, optimizes power quality and supports finished‑product EMC compliance certification.![]()
It is widely applied in three‑phase industrial automation facilities, inverter & frequency converter systems, motor drive units, CNC machinery, industrial control cabinets, PLC control systems, high‑power industrial power supplies and production‑line automation equipment with three‑phase power input. It can be adopted for new‑product development as well as anti‑interference upgrading of already‑operational machines.
